Pueblo County’s coroner says autopsies on two young sisters and their babysitter confirm their deaths were a result of drowning.

The coroner, Brian Cotter, said “it was accidental.”

Authorities have identified the three victims as 3-year-old Azucena Gandarilla, 6-year-old Amaya Gandarilla and 17-year-old Joo Lee. Police say Joo was a “sitter” for the younger girls and that she was watching the pair at the time of the drowning.

Officers responding Monday afternoon to reports of a drowning at Pueblo Grande Village at 999 Fortino Blvd. , but efforts of first responders came too late.

Police say they are investigating what led up to the drownings. Investigators have not said exactly how they believe the three ended up in the pool.
